SNOQUALMIE, Wash. — Forecasted heavy snow is prompting the Northwest Avalanche Center to issue an avalanche warning for the Cascades.
According to NWAC, the snow, winds, and snow transitioning to rain at lower elevations is creating a risk of avalanches along Stevens and Snoqualmie passes, Mt. Hood, and the west slopes of the Cascades in Washington.
Travel along the passes is not recommended as there is high risk of avalanches.
The warning is in place until 6 p.m. Thursday.
